From: DeepECA: an end-to-end learning framework for protein contact prediction from a multiple sequence alignment

Fig. 2

a One example of weight distribution in the sequences of one MSA for T0843 on the CASP11 dataset. b Accuracy improvement depends on the number of sequences in an MSA. We divided 160 protein domains into five bins according to their lengths. The numbers of proteins in the bins are equal (i.e., 32 protein domains in each bin). c Baseline Model top L accuracy shown against the Weighted MSA Model when we have over 200 homologous sequences and d with fewer than 200 homologous sequences
